Cathedral in Homs hosts chanting evening marking Easter season

Published: 2026/04/01 11:13 AM
Updated: 2026/04/01 11:15 AM
Cathedral in Homs hosts chanting evening marking Easter season
Cathedral of the Virgin Mary Um Al-Zenar in Homs

Homs, April 1 (SANA) The Cathedral of the Virgin Mary Um Al-Zenar in Homs hosted a chanting evening titled “I Come to You” on Tuesday, featuring the cathedral choir alongside guest musicians as part of celebrations for the Christian holiday season.

Hymns performed in Arabic and Syriac reflected themes of love, peace and hope associated with the occasion, held at one of Syria’s prominent religious landmarks.

Father Michael Al-Khalil, priest of the cathedral, said the recital embodied the spiritual meanings of Holy Week, beginning with Palm Sunday.

Choir director Iskandar Yeshua noted that the event, held at the transition from March to April, coincides with the arrival of spring and the start of the festive period, adding that the program included diverse performances, including participation by a singer from Al-Qahtaniyah in the Syrian Jazira.

Music director George Al-Dawi said the evening highlighted the significance of the Passion of Christ and Easter, promoting a message of hope for peace and stability in Syria.

The Cathedral of the Virgin Mary Um Al-Zenar is among Syria’s notable historical and religious sites, hosting cultural and spiritual events throughout the year that contribute to community cohesion.
